GUINEA-BISSAU:

Growing conditions are favourable but civil disturbances have affected agricultural activities. Fighting, which started in Bissau on 7 June and continued up to 26 July, the date of the signature of a cease-fire, impeded normal agricultural activities at the critical planting period. The cease-fire facilitated the resumption of normal activities in the fields but areas planted are likely to be reduced following insecurity and shortages of seeds. Satellite imagery indicates that rains remained widespread and particularly abundant over the entire country in September, leading to desalinisation of swamp rice fields and development of recently transplanted rice.
